[Following is a volunteer review of "E M P Honeymoon" by Dorothy May Mercer.]

Two lovebirds were going to finally see their dreams and imaginations come true as they took off for the honeymoon Kelly had spent hours and weeks choosing. It was on a Caribbean island, a place with a beautiful landscape and natural disposition. How did the honeymoon go? Were there any contradictions?

This book contains a lot of enchanting characters. McBride; a crusading senator of the United States, Tim; Carson City police, Cynthia; McBride personal security, Kelly, Steve, Sky, and more. They put in collective efforts to fight and eliminate their terrorists and save their country from suffering and egregious loss, which would have put the country in a state of mourning.

Tom, on his honeymoon, went out to dive on a boat, whereas Kelly went to get some gifts from a pigsty shop. Fortunately and unfortunately, she saw a high-tech lab, which all seemed weird. What will this kind of technology be doing in a disguised store? All hands on deck and all force teams started the operation as they feared an attack on the US.

My encounter with this book was sure to be a tremendous one. I enjoyed the thrilling scenes in this book. I also loved the way technology was harnessed in this book; paradoxically, this book is revealing what the future will look like as technology advances. I was a lot puzzled reading about the terrorist's plan of attack. It would have caused a lot of damage if they were successful. I also enjoyed the role the terrorists played in this book. Though Colonel Rhee Su-jin's role seemed more interesting to me.

The only flaw I witnessed while reading this book was in the development of the antagonist's characters. It felt like, with their high-tech knowledge, they should be brutal and tough enough for the US and Canada, but the way they were tackled seemed a bit easy to me. Other than this, I had no issues with this book. I did not see any errors in this book, which shows that it was exceptionally well-edited by the author.

I rate this book, E M P Honeymoon by Dorothy May Mercer, 5 out of 5 stars. I did not see any reason to deduct any stars from this book, as it satisfied my enthusiasm for it. I commend the author for this. I recommend this science fiction book to people who love books full of action and thrilling scenes. Have a fun read.
